If Mario Was a Plumber and Ryu a Karate Instructor: The Highest and Lowest Earnings in Video Gaming | Games | Entertainment
If you’ve ever wondered who would top the list of real-life video game characters, then you’re in luck. A new study by online gaming company Solitaired explored which video game icons would earn the most money if their virtual profession was real, and who would earn the least.
At the top of the rich list is Borderlands’ Handsome Jack, with an estimated earnings of £333,043 as CEO. Special forces soldier Solid Snake is next with earnings of over £100,000, followed by Resident Evil virologist Albert Wesker.
The study uses data from salary comparison sites, as well as publicly available pay brackets to find an average annual salary for more than 50 video game characters.
Call of Duty’s Alex Mason, Max Payne and LA Noire detective Cole Phelps are other high earners, alongside Half Life’s Gordon Freeman and Splinter Cell’s Sam Fisher.
Pac-Man – who is listed as a Japanese security guard – tops the list of lowest earners, with an estimated average income of £15,916.
Martial arts instructor Ryu is also among the lowest paid, earning an average of £21,713.

The 20 highest earning video game characters…
1. Handsome Jack (Borderlands 2) – CEO – £333,043
2. Solid Snake (Metal Gear Solid) – Special Forces Trooper – £107,517
3. Albert Wesker (Resident Evil) – Virologist – £90,519
4. Alex Mason (Call of Duty) – CIA Agent – £82,317
5. Max Payne (Max Payne) – NYPD Detective – £75,922
6. Cole Phelps (LA Noire) – LAPD Detective – £71,846
7. Gordon Freeman (Half-Life) – Research Associate Scientist – £70,145
8. Arthur Morgan (Red Dead Redemption 2) – Bounty Hunter – £69,750
9. Mortimer Goth (The Sims) – Scientist – £69,076
10. Isaac Clarke (Dead Space) – Engineer – £64,859
11. Duke Nukem (Duke Nukem) – CIA Special Agent – £62,837
12. CJ Johnson (Grand Theft Auto: San Andreas) – Contractor – £59,626
13. Bella Goth (The Sims) – Intelligence Seeker – £58,363
14. Michael De Santa (Grand Theft Auto V) – Film Producer – £54,563
15. Leon S Kennedy (Resident Evil) – Police Officer – £54,113
16. Homer Simpson (Simpson’s Hit and Run) – Nuclear Technician – £53,629
17. Master Chief (Halo) – Master Chief Petty Officer – £53,491
18. Doom Slayer (Doom) – Navy Gunnery Master Sergeant – £53,490
19. Sam Fisher (Splinter Cell) – Navy Seal – £48,729
20. Chris Redfield and Jill Valentine (Resident Evil) – SWAT Team Member (£48,158)
The 20 lowest paid video game characters…
1. Pac-Man (Pac-Man) – Security Guard – £15,916
2. Link (Legend of Zelda) – Knight – £19,661
3. Cloud Strife (Final Fantasy) – Private First Class – £19,964
4. Desmond Miles (Assassin’s Creed) – Bartender – £21,408
5. Ryu (Street Fighter) – Martial Arts Instructor – £21,723
6. Marcus Fenix (Gears of War) – Army Sergeant – £24,119
7. Don Lothario (The Sims) – Medical Intern – £24,784
8. Geralt of Rivia (The Witcher) – Pest Controller – £24,906
9. Niko Bellic – (Grand Theft Auto IV) – Taxi Driver – £25,521
10. Lightning (Final Fantasy) – Security Guard – £29,084
11. Crash Bandicoot – (Crash Bandicoot) – Bodyguard – £29,670
12. John Marston – (Red Dead Redemption) – Breeder – £32,770
13. Mario – (Super Mario Bros) – Plumber – £32,895
14. Tom Nook (Animal Crossing) – Estate Agent – £33,812
15. Isabelle – (Animal Crossing) – Secretary – £34,071
16. Freddy Fazbear – (Five Nights at Freddy’s) – Mascot – £35,078
17. Captain John ‘Soap’ MacTavish – (Call of Duty 4: Modern Warfare) – Army Sergeant – £35,953
18. Booker DeWitt (Bioshock Infinite) – Private Investigator – £36,000
19. Spyro (Spyro the Dragon) – Jeweler – £36,516
20. Sonic the Hedgehog (Sonic the Hedgehog) – Pro Athlete – £36,592
